Recognizing Low-VOC Paints
When you select low-VOC paints, you're going with a product that sends out less unpredictable organic substances, which can be harmful to both your wellness and the environment.
VOCs are chemicals found in many paint items that can vaporize right into the air and add to indoor air contamination. By selecting low-VOC options, you're reducing the variety of these emissions, making your living space safer.
Low-VOC paints generally consist of 50 grams per litre or less VOCs, compared to standard paints that can have up to 250 grams per litre. This implies that when you repaint your home with low-VOC products, you're not simply making a choice for visual appeals; you're additionally taking a step in the direction of a much healthier indoor atmosphere.
These paints are available in a variety of finishes and shades, so you will not have to jeopardize on design. They're suitable for both interior and exterior tasks, offering sturdiness and coverage like their traditional equivalents.
Plus, lots of makers are now focusing on producing low-VOC formulas without sacrificing efficiency. Prospective Drawbacks to Take Into Consideration
While low-VOC paints use various benefits, there are some possible drawbacks to bear in mind. One substantial concern is their performance contrasted to standard paints. Low-VOC choices might not always give the very same degree of sturdiness and insurance coverage, which can cause even more regular touch-ups or a demand for extra layers. This can be discouraging and taxing during your painting job.
An additional concern is the drying out time. Low-VOC paints usually take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can extend your job timeline. If you're on a limited routine, this might be a disadvantage to think about.
You ought to additionally realize that low-VOC paints can often have a various finish or structure. If you're aiming for a certain aesthetic, see to it to check samples to make sure the result meets your expectations.
Finally, while low-VOC paints are usually more secure, they can still release some fumes. Appropriate ventilation is essential throughout and after application, so be prepared to air out your room effectively.
